Speech dereverberation using NMF with regularized room impulse response

Nikhil Mohanan, Rajbabu Velmurugan, Preeti Rao

Abstract

In this paper, various regularizations on the room impulse response (RIR) are proposed to obtain better single-channel speech dereverberation in the non-negative matrix factorization (NMF) framework. The regularizations on the RIR are motivated by the spectral domain representation of the RIR. To obtain better estimates of the RIR and clean speech, we propose three modifications (i) to obtain a sparse RIR (ii) a frequency envelop constrained RIR and (iii) to include the early part of the RIR. The performance of the proposed regularizers are evaluated by considering speech enhancement measures. While it is observed that the regularizers lead to an improved estimate of the RIR, they do not necessarily lead to speech enhancement in all the cases. For the experiments conducted using the RIRs from the REVERB 2014 challenge and sentences from the TIMIT database, the regularizer that includes the early part of the RIR shows reasonable improvement in speech enhancement measures.
